Join us, and discover why U.S. News & World Report has named us one of America's Best Hospitals!Cedars-Sinai's Preoperative (PreOp) and Post Anesthesia care units (PACU) total over 100 bays within the main medical center and Advanced Health Science Pavilion. Our perianesthesia nurses are highly skilled critical care professionals who care for patients as they are undergoing or regaining consciousness from anesthesia. They continuously monitor and record patients' vital signs, monitor for side effects and adverse reactions related to anesthesia and are prepared to handle emergency situations if needed to ensure patients' safety.As a Registered Nurse in PreOp PACU:Assume responsibility and accountability for the application of the nursing process and the delivery of patient care within this specialty patient population.Provide and accurately document direct and indirect patient care services that ensures the safety, comfort, personal hygiene, and protection of patients in a timely mannerProvide patient education on disease prevention and restorative measures.Provide administration of medications and therapeutic agents necessary to implement treatment, disease prevention, or rehabilitative plan of care.Perform skin tests, immunizations, phlebotomy and the initiation of peripheral venous access.Observe and assess signs and symptoms of illness, reactions to medications/treatments, general behavior, and/or general physical condition to determine normal versus abnormal characteristics and initiate emergency procedures when indicated.Plan and implement individualized patient care based on observations.
